Asia’s Smartphone Ecosystem Accelerates AI Integration and Manufacturing Modernization

Spread the love

India’s edge-AI adoption outpaces ASEAN by 40% while manufacturing infrastructure converges on AI-driven production methodologies, creating complementary innovation pathways across the region.

Recent benchmarking reveals accelerated deployment of specialized AI processors in India’s smartphone sector as manufacturing ecosystems demonstrate remarkable progress in precision automation systems.

Verified Developments

Industry assessments confirm ongoing deployment of edge-AI processors in India’s premium smartphone segment, with recent benchmarking showing 40% faster implementation than ASEAN regional averages. Manufacturing infrastructure reports indicate India achieving Technology Readiness Level 7 in high-volume assembly through precision robotics systems, while Taiwan continues sub-3nm semiconductor innovations. Supply chain analysis reveals growing competency in heterogenous chip packaging within Indian facilities.

Regional Innovation Patterns

Distinct innovation pathways are emerging: India’s smartphone market demonstrates rapid consumer-driven AI adoption focused on computational photography and voice interfaces, creating opportunities for localized feature development. Concurrently, ASEAN manufacturers prioritize multi-lingual AI implementations, presenting openings for language processing innovations. Manufacturing ecosystems show complementary strengths – Taiwan’s vertically integrated semiconductor ecosystem enables AI accelerator co-development, while India’s modular production cells offer agile response capabilities for evolving component requirements.

Adoption Timeline Analysis

Recent months show accelerating convergence in AI-optimized production methodologies. India’s manufacturing growth trajectory (68% YoY robotics deployment) mirrors Taiwan’s historical phase-transition period, suggesting potential for accelerated capability development through 2025. Technology strategists observe ASEAN’s opportunity to leapfrog legacy architectures through hybrid cloud-edge implementations during this transition. Current patterns indicate Taiwan maintaining leadership in nanometer-scale precision while India demonstrates superior reconfiguration capabilities – complementary strengths positioning the region for collective advancement in the 2023-2025 innovation window.
